“We’ve certainly heard the rumblings,” Dipoto acknowledged. “I guess the simplest way for me to address the timing of it is we have got 11 games left, (and) we understand we are climbing a pretty formidable hill both in our schedule and what that means for our potential to make the playoffs. We have a pretty decorated history as an organization of pushing fast forward (with prospects) when we may have been better off showing a little discipline. And we are going to try to exercise the discipline this time and just play it smart keep the long-term plan in place and make sure we are doing the right thing for the health of the organization.”
